‘Fueled-by-rage’ Sean Penn: No ‘chance in hell’ Trump re-elected
September 9, 2019 | Frieda Powers
“Fast Times at Ridgemont High†star Sean Penn has again blasted President Trump, this time on stage at a California event where he declared there is “no chance in hell†Trump will get re-elected.
The filmmaker predicted an “exponential jump†in the number of younger voters who will not support a second term for the president, speaking with fellow actor Nick Offerman in Los Angeles, according to The Hollywood Reporter.
Penn was on hand to promote his new novel “Bob Honey Sings Jimmy Crack Corn,†when he reportedly made the remarks on stage at the Los Angeles event Saturday. His book, a follow-up to 2018’s “Bob Honey Who Just Do Stufff,†is “literature of the ludicrous,†according to the Oscar-winning star of “Mystic River†and “Milk,†and tells the story of an international assassin.
“As it turns out, leading up to the election of 2016, I was going to f**king kill myself if I didn’t find a way out of just focusing on what the hell was happening,†Penn told Offerman. “So I decided to take everything I thought and felt and exaggerated it and exaggerated the language in ways that would keep me giggling through one of the ugliest periods of conscious participation the country has ever had.â€
The 49-year old actor unloaded on Trump with his political commentary, noting that he tackles his writing in the den of his house which “has a fireplace in it, and might or might not have a model representing our current president hanging from a noose. And it may or may not have a button on that model where you can press it and hear quotations in his voice. And that’s where I write.â€
